    He doesn't seem able to sustain momentum, he has been unlucky with injuries and this has caused his activity to be patchy. He has shown a vulnerability when being caught by Anderson and Smith but he also seems to have good recovery powers. He also shows a killer instinct, when he has someone hurt he will try and get the job finished.

    He has shown the skills, power, variety and toughness to be amongst the best.

    I am a big fan, I believe he can at least challenge for a world title whether it's at SMW or he moves up in the future. Just want to see him busier.

    George Groves has the makings of becoming a world champion, he has the talent and temperament to go very far. He has had some injuries that have resulted in him being very inactive and fighters like De Gale, who he has beat, have won titles a head of him. His last performance was excellent considering the cut he had and the bombs he took. Groves needs to be more active as he is still relatively inexperienced.
